What will the weather in Bad Schlema be like during my vacation?
The warmest months in Bad Schlema are usually August and July with an average temp of 62°F. January and February are the chilliest months when the average temp is 34°F. The rainiest months are August and July.

Things to do in Bad Schlema for first time

A three-day trip to Bad Schlema offers travelers a chance to unwind in thermal baths, explore scenic parks and lakes, and engage in adventure activities like hiking and water sports. With its mix of historic charm and natural beauty, it's an ideal destination for relaxation and exploration. Here's a quick itinerary to make the most of your trip to Bad Schlema:

  • Day 1: Begin your adventure at the charming Schneeberg Rathaus, a beautiful town hall that showcases impressive architecture and rich local history. After soaking in the sights, head over to the Eibenstock Spa Gardens, where you can relax amidst beautifully landscaped gardens and enjoy the serene atmosphere. Finally, make your way to the Eibenstock Dam, a splendid spot for scenic views and a peaceful walk along the water—perfect for unwinding after a busy day of exploration.
  • Day 2: Start your day at the stunning St. Wolfgang Church, known for its impressive architecture and peaceful ambiance—a great place for reflection. Next, embark on a hike to Auersberg, where you’ll be rewarded with breathtaking views of the surrounding landscape. Conclude your day at the majestic Schwarzenberg Castle, a historical gem that offers fascinating insights into the region's past and stunning panoramas from its vantage point.
  • Day 3: Kick off your day at the Museum fuer Bergmaennische Volkskunst, where you can dive into the rich cultural heritage of the mining community. Then, visit the enchanting Klaffenbach Moated Castle, a picturesque site perfect for exploring its lush grounds and historical exhibits. Wrap up your itinerary at the Museum Daetz Centre Lichtenstein, where contemporary and traditional crafts come together, providing an engaging experience that highlights the artistry of the region.

Best time to go to Bad Schlema

Bad Schlema experiences its lowest average temperature in January, at 31.3°F (-0.4°C), while July and August are the hottest months, with an average temperature of 64.9°F (18.3°C). August is typically the wettest month. If you’re looking to soak up the lively atmosphere in Bad Schlema, January, September, and December are the peak months to visit, bustling with fellow travelers. During this peak period, the weather is mostly sunny to mostly cloudy, accompanied by light rainfall. However, if you prefer a more relaxed experience, May to July are perfect for a quieter getaway, marked by light rainfall and mostly sunny conditions.
